MinimizeToTrayPlus Lets You Minimize The Applications To The System Tray !

MinimizeToTrayPlus is one of the useful extensions for minimizing Mozilla Firefox or Thunderbird to the tray. In this addon, you can have a number of quick and flexible ways to do this function. Therefore, you can use the Minimize To Tray option from the File Menu. Instead, you can press Ctrl+Shift+M on your keyboard. At the same time, you can also check a box in the extension options window to force applications to be minimized on the system tray. Moreover, there is also a toolbar button for you to click.

The addon features a number of options in order to control it’s functions as you like. Therefore, you can set or reset whether the application should be minimized to the tray instead of taskbar. Moreover, you can restore on a single or double click and it should minimize the application on close.

Some Important Key Features.
•    The addon minimizes the applications to the system tray.
•    You can have tray menu for performing certain functions of the programs.
•    You can start the applications when system starts.
•    It will always show a tray icon for the applications
•    You can have an option to restore minimized windows if it is invoked by another program.
•    You can have a number of options to customize the function of the addon.
•    It features a variety of methods to minimize the applications Menu item, keyboard shortcut, and Toolbar Button.
•    It is available in over 25 different translations/locales.
